Ajaran Tao oleh Lao Tzu

Lao Tzu, filsuf China.
People conform to the Laws of the Earth.
The Earth conforms to the Law of heaven.
Heaven conforms to the Way (Tao).
The Tao conforms to its own nature.

Just as activity beats the cold,
And inactivity (stillness) beats the heat,
Purity and stillness can heal the word.

Inflexible soldiers cannot win (a victory).
And the hardest trees are readiest for an axe to chop them down tough guys sink to the bottom while flexible people rise to the top.

“A good door is locket without bolt or bar, but cannot be opened.
Good binding has no rope or knots, yet cannot be untied“.


If the people are free of avarice and desire, even the most cunning grafter has no opportunity to corrupt them.

When you value rare things high, you turn honest people into thieves. If you show people exciting things, you will make them covetous and greedy.

A sage:
Let go of extremism
Let go of luxury
Let go of apathy.

The world is a sacred vessel.
It should not be meddled with.
It should not be owned.
If you try to meddle with it, you will ruin it.
If you try to own it, you will lose it.

Even a nine-storied terrace began with a single basket of dirt.
Even a 1.000 mile journey began as a single step.

Just as the value of a house lies in is location, the value of a mind lies in its depth,
The value of giving lies in the presence of a generous spirit, The value of words lies in their reliability


Deal with difficult tasks while they are easy. Act on large issues while they are small.

No disaster is worse than being discontented. No omen (for your future) worse than being greedy. Yes, if you can find (true) contentment, it will last forever.
